The following persons have the powers of a peace officer:

1.

Sheriffs of counties and of metropolitan police departments, their deputies and correctional officers.

2.

Marshals, police officers and correctional officers of cities and towns.

3.

The bailiff of the Supreme Court.

4.

The bailiffs and deputy marshals of the district courts, justice courts and municipal courts whose duties require them to carry weapons and make arrests.

5.

Subject to the provisions of NRS 258.070, constables and their deputies.
